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Ellisburg

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

The "Spring Replacement" Bait-and-Switch

You're quoted a low price for a spring replacement over the phone. Once the technician arrives, they claim your specific door needs a "heavy-duty" or "commercial-grade" spring that costs two to three times more. You're pressured to approve the upgrade or pay a service fee.

🚫

The "Urgent Safety Hazard" Upsell

The technician points to a minor issue — a slightly worn roller or loose bolt — and claims it's an immediate safety hazard that could cause the door to collapse. They insist on expensive repairs before leaving.

🚫

The Parts Phantom

You're charged for brand-name or high-end parts like Wayne Dalton or LiftMaster, but cheaper generic parts are installed. The invoice lists premium parts, but your door continues to have issues.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Always ask for proof of general liability insurance and workers' compensation insurance. A legitimate pro will provide these documents without hesitation. Call the insurance carrier to verify the policy is active if something feels off.

2

Licensing

New York State does not require a specific license for garage door repair technicians, but check for local Jefferson County business registration. Ask for their NYS Certificate of Authority (sales tax ID) and verify they are registered to do business in New York.

3

References

Ask for 3 recent local references — ideally from homes in Ellisburg or nearby Jefferson County. Follow up and ask about pricing accuracy, job cleanliness, and whether the work was completed on time and on budget.

Protection FAQs

How do I know if a garage door repair company in Ellisburg is legitimate?

Start by checking for a physical address in or near Ellisburg, and verify their NYS Certificate of Authority. Ask for proof of general liability and workers' comp insurance. A legitimate company will also have consistent online reviews and provide written estimates before any work begins.

What's the typical cost for garage door spring replacement in Ellisburg?

Torsion spring replacement typically ranges from $150 to $350 including labor. Be very suspicious of anyone quoting under $100 — that's a classic bait-and-switch tactic. Always get at least two quotes before committing.

Should I pay upfront for garage door repair in Ellisburg?

No. Reputable garage door repair companies typically do not demand full payment upfront. A small deposit (10-20%) is sometimes reasonable for special-order parts, but never pay the full amount until the work is completed to your satisfaction.

What should I do if I think I've been scammed by a garage door repair company?

Document everything — receipts, photos of the work, and any communications. File a complaint with the New York Attorney General's Office and the Jefferson County Consumer Affairs office. You can also report the business to the Better Business Bureau.

Are mobile garage door repair vans that drive through Ellisburg neighborhoods legitimate?

Be very cautious. These are often unlicensed operators who lack insurance, use cheap parts, and have no local reputation to protect. A trustworthy Ellisburg-area pro doesn't need to canvas neighborhoods — they get business through local referrals and online presence.

How long should a garage door repair warranty last?

Most reputable companies offer at least 1 year on labor and between 1-5 years on parts (especially springs). If a company offers no warranty or only a 30-day warranty, that's a red flag. Get the warranty terms in writing before agreeing to any work.
